## Authentication

The Drainpipe autoscaler authenticates twice: once against the broker to read queue depth, and once against the internal Drainpipe control plane to issue scale decisions. Broker credentials come from the standard secrets mount and need no review here. Control-plane auth uses a static service key loaded at startup; the loader validates its format and fails fast if it is missing, which is the behavior exercised in the new unit tests. For local runs, the test fixture uses the following key.

API key for yahig-tadup: kto7_ubizbYm

[ ] Gallery labels — Merrow Hall run. Collect crate of etched labels for the Tidewater Wing from Fenlock Signworks, dock 3. Verify count against manifest (44 pieces), foam dividers intact, no loose corners. Curator Ilsa Pravek signs before departure. Courier meets our runner at the Merrow Hall service gate; the hand-over phrase is below.

handover note for tadug-yaguf: the aldath pelwyn courier leaves the casox norwyn briix silok zorok kasdor aldion quenox ledger at gate 2653 under passcode 959015

Handing DNS flakiness on Larkmouth over to Priya's rotation. Resolver intermittently times out on the internal zone; restarting the cache helps for ~an hour. Support: if customers report lookup failures, note timestamps and ping the on-call. If you need to unlock the resolver admin console, the recovery passphrase is right below.

unlock words, kajeg-fahif: holmir-casael-novdor